Understanding the Types of 100kw Generators
When you look into the market for a 100kw generator set, you'll quickly find that not all units generating 100kW are the same. The primary distinction often lies in the fuel type and engine technology used. Diesel generators are arguably the most common in this power range, known for their robustness, efficiency, and long lifespan. They are reliable for continuous operation and often preferred for backup power due to the relative stability of diesel fuel. However, they require proper ventilation and produce more emissions and noise compared to some alternatives. Natural gas or propane generators are another popular option, especially where natural gas lines are readily available. These often offer cleaner emissions and quieter operation than diesel, making them suitable for locations where noise or air quality is a concern. Interestingly enough, they can also be easier to refuel if connected to a utility line, eliminating the need for fuel storage tanks and deliveries. The choice between diesel and gas depends heavily on your specific application, fuel availability, local regulations, and budget, both for initial purchase and ongoing fuel costs. There are also bi-fuel options that combine diesel and natural gas, offering flexibility and extended runtime, though these tend to be more complex and costly initially.
Key Components of a Quality 100kw Generator Set
A 100kw generator set is more than just an engine; it's a system comprised of several crucial components working in harmony. At its heart is the engine, the prime mover that converts fuel into mechanical energy. Reputable manufacturers use industrial-grade engines designed for demanding, continuous operation. You'll find engines from well-known names like Cummins, Perkins, Volvo Penta, and others in quality 100kw sets. Next is the alternator, which converts the mechanical energy from the engine into electrical energy. The quality of the alternator significantly impacts the stability and quality of the power output. Voltage regulation (AVR) is a critical feature here, ensuring a consistent voltage supply, which is vital for protecting sensitive electronics. The control panel acts as the brain of the generator, monitoring engine parameters, managing voltage and frequency, and often featuring automatic transfer switch (ATS) compatibility. A good control panel provides clear diagnostics and allows for easy operation and monitoring. Finally, the enclosure protects the generator from the elements and significantly reduces noise levels. For many installations, especially in populated areas, a sound-attenuated enclosure is non-negotiable for meeting noise regulations and minimizing disturbance. Understanding the quality and specifications of these components is key to evaluating the overall reliability and performance of the unit.

Planning for Installation: What You Need to Know
Acquiring a 100kw generator set is only half the battle; proper installation is critical for performance, safety, and compliance. This isn't a DIY project for most. Installation requires expertise covering electrical, mechanical, and sometimes plumbing aspects. Key considerations include the generator's location – it must be on a stable, level surface (like a concrete pad), accessible for maintenance, and positioned away from windows, doors, and air intakes to prevent exhaust fumes from entering buildings. Adequate ventilation is paramount for engine cooling and preventing overheating. Exhaust systems must safely route fumes away from occupied areas, often requiring insulated piping and mufflers to meet noise and safety standards. Fuel storage is another major factor; whether it's a bulk diesel tank or connection to a natural gas line, it must comply with local codes and safety regulations. Electrical connections involve integrating the generator into your existing electrical system, typically through an automatic transfer switch (ATS) that seamlessly switches power sources when the grid fails. Proper grounding and wiring are non-negotiable safety requirements. Maintaining Your 100kw Generator for Longevity
Just like any complex piece of machinery, a 100kw generator set requires regular maintenance to ensure it performs reliably when needed most and achieves its maximum lifespan. Neglecting maintenance is a common pitfall that can lead to costly breakdowns and reduced efficiency. A comprehensive maintenance schedule typically includes routine checks such as inspecting fluid levels (oil, coolant, fuel), checking batteries for charge and corrosion, inspecting belts and hoses for wear, and ensuring the air and fuel filters are clean. Periodic oil changes, coolant flushes, and filter replacements are essential service items, usually recommended based on operating hours or calendar time, whichever comes first. Load testing is also crucial; running the generator under a significant load periodically helps identify potential issues before an actual emergency and ensures the engine and alternator are performing correctly. Keeping detailed service records is highly recommended. Sizing and Selecting the Right 100kw Generator
While we're focusing on the 100kw generator set, it's crucial to understand how to arrive at this specific power requirement for your needs. Proper sizing is critical; an undersized generator won't handle your load, leading to potential damage or failure, while an oversized one costs more initially, is less fuel-efficient when running below capacity, and can even suffer from 'wet stacking' (unburned fuel accumulation). The process involves calculating your total power requirements, including both continuous running loads and the higher surge loads required to start motors and other inductive equipment. This usually requires a load study or professional assessment of your facility's electrical system. Factors beyond pure wattage also influence selection, such as voltage and phase requirements (single-phase or three-phase), the frequency needed (50Hz or 60Hz depending on location), whether you need standby, prime, or continuous power capabilities, and the specific environmental conditions it will operate in (temperature, altitude). Other considerations include noise restrictions, emissions regulations, fuel storage capacity, and the physical space available for installation. Getting the right guidance here is paramount. Many experts agree that a slight buffer in size is wise, but significant oversizing should be avoided. Considering the Investment and Ongoing Costs
Investing in a 100kw generator set represents a significant financial commitment, but it's one that provides tangible returns in terms of operational continuity and security. The initial purchase price for a diesel generator 100kw price can vary widely based on brand, features (like sound attenuation, control panel sophistication), and whether it's new or used. Installation costs must also be factored in, which can be substantial depending on the complexity of the site preparation, electrical work, and fuel system setup. Beyond the upfront expenditure, there are ongoing operating costs. Fuel is often the largest variable cost, depending on how frequently and for how long the generator runs, and fluctuations in fuel prices. Maintenance costs, including parts, labor, and preventative maintenance contracts, are another necessary expense to budget for. Insurance and potential permitting fees also contribute to the total cost of ownership. While these costs exist, they must be weighed against the potentially far greater costs of power outages – lost revenue, damaged equipment, safety hazards, and reputational damage. A reliable 100kw unit is an asset that protects your bottom line and ensures critical functions remain operational. Looking at the long-term total cost of ownership, rather than just the initial purchase price, provides a more accurate picture of the investment value.
Ensuring Safe Operation and Compliance
Operating a 100kw generator set involves inherent risks that must be managed through strict safety protocols and adherence to regulations. Safety starts with proper installation, as discussed earlier, ensuring correct electrical connections, grounding, and exhaust ventilation. During operation, trained personnel are crucial. They must understand the control panel, emergency shutdown procedures, and safe refueling practices. Refueling diesel units, for instance, should only occur when the generator is shut off and cooled down to prevent fire hazards. Lockout/Tagout procedures are essential during maintenance to prevent accidental starts. Beyond operational safety, environmental and regulatory compliance is increasingly important. This includes meeting emissions standards set by bodies like the EPA, which vary based on engine type and usage (standby vs. prime power). Noise regulations are also common, particularly in urban or residential areas, necessitating appropriate sound attenuation measures. Fuel storage tanks must comply with strict environmental regulations regarding containment and spill prevention. Permitting is often required for installing and operating generators of this size, and regulations can vary significantly by location. Staying informed about and compliant with all relevant local, state, and federal regulations is not just a legal requirement but a critical part of responsible generator ownership and operation.
